Skillsoft Announces 11th Annual Series of Live Events Providing Exclusive Access to Brightest Minds Discussing the Future of Work

A prestigious group of professors, industry experts and best-selling authors to participate in interactive events on workplace innovation, productivity and leadership

BOSTON – January 24, 2019 –Skillsoft, a global leader in corporate learning, today announced its 11th season of Live Events, an exclusive series of interactive webcasts hosted by nationally recognized thought leaders in workplace innovation, productivity and leadership. The 2019 Live Events lineup features an array of experts carefully curated to address critical issues and key competencies essential for today’s leaders to succeed.

The 2019 Live Events features leading academics such as Michael Roberto of Harvard Business School and Bryant University, Stew Friedman of the Wharton School at the University of Pennsylvania and Cal Newport of Georgetown University. Additionally, several New York Times best-selling and renowned authors, including Daniel Pink, Dan Coyle and Erica Dhawan, will present on topics related to business innovation, productivity and leadership.

“The Skillsoft Live Events series brings the power to inspire and deeply engage learners across organizations and industries,” said Heide Abelli, senior vice president of content product management, Skillsoft. “The interactive nature of the events is designed to help leaders not only learn from each expert but also encourage them to engage in thought-provoking discussions about the future of work with those they lead.”

Skillsoft Live Events

Skillsoft’s 2019 Live Events series includes:

  • February 6, 2019: Unlocking Creativity: How to Solve Any Problem and Make the Best Decisions Michael Roberto, a professor of Management at Bryant University and former Harvard Business School faculty member, will present the six organizational mindsets that inhibit creativity in the workplace and demonstrate how barriers can be overcome to unleash creativity and organizational innovation.
  • March 6, 2019: Get Big Things Done: The Power of Connectional Intelligence Erica Dhawan, the world’s leading authority on connectional intelligence and author of Get Big Things Done: The Power of Connectional Intelligence, will provide the rationale for how anyone, by developing Connectional Intelligence, can maximize personal potential and achieve breakthrough performance in the workplace.
  • April 16, 2019: The Scientific Secrets of Perfect Timing Daniel Pink, the New York Times best-selling author of To Sell Is Human, Drive and A Whole New Mind, will keynote Skillsoft’s annual user conference, Perspectives. In the keynote, which is based on his latest book, When: The Scientific Secrets of Perfect Timing, Pink will explain that timing is really a science – one that we can all use to make smarter decisions, enhance productivity and increase organizational performance.
  • May 14, 2019: Total Leadership: Be a Better Leader, Lead a Richer Life Stew Friedman, Wharton School professor at the University of Pennsylvania and founding director of the Wharton Leadership Program, will refute the idea that the more we strive to win on one dimension, the more we sacrifice performance and satisfaction in the other three: family, community and private self.
  • September 26, 2019: Digital Minimalism: Choosing a Focused Life in a Noisy World Cal Newport, associate professor of computer science at Georgetown University and the author of five books, including Deep Work, will introduce the concept of digital minimalism, a philosophy for technology use that has already improved countless lives. Newport will explain how common-sense tips such as turning off notifications or occasional rituals like observing a digital sabbath don't go far enough in helping us take back control of our technological lives and attempts to unplug completely are complicated by the demands of family, friends and work.
  • November 12, 2019: The Culture Code: The New Science of Successful Groups Dan Coyle, the award-winning New York Times best-selling author of several books on leadership and performance, including The Talent Code, The Little Book of Talent and a new book, The Culture Code: The Secrets of Highly Successful Groups, will provide the evidence for a simple but important insight — that great groups don’t just happen by chance. They are built according to three universal rules.
